Understanding Grey Hair and Its Unique Needs

Grey hair, often perceived as a symbol of wisdom and elegance, comes with its distinct characteristics that differentiate it from pigmented hair. As hair turns grey, it typically undergoes structural changes. This may include increased porosity, which can lead to hair feeling drier and fragile. The lack of pigment can also cause grey hair to reflect light differently, making it appear duller and more prone to frizz and flyaways.

To effectively care for grey hair, choosing the right hair products is essential. Many individuals with grey hair opt for moisturizing shampoos and conditioners that help maintain hydration and reduce brittleness. Moreover, grey hair can be more susceptible to heat damage, thus necessitating the use of hair dryers that offer controlled settings and protective features. Understanding these needs can help you select a hair dryer adept at addressing these specific concerns.

Incorporating the correct techniques while using a hair dryer can greatly influence the overall health of grey hair. For example, utilizing a lower heat setting and keeping the dryer at a safe distance from the hair can help minimize damage. Furthermore, hair dryers equipped with diffusers can assist in maintaining natural texture while minimizing heat exposure. Knowledge of these factors can empower individuals with grey hair to maintain its beauty and health.

Technology in Hair Dryers: What Matters for Grey Hair?

Modern hair dryers come packed with various technologies designed to enhance performance and hair health. For individuals with grey hair, features such as ionic technology are particularly beneficial. This technology works by emitting negative ions that help to neutralize static, reduce frizz, and add shine to hair. As grey hair is often more prone to dryness, ionic hair dryers can help retain moisture while drying, resulting in a sleeker finish.

Another crucial feature to consider is heat regulation. Hair dryers with smart heat control or multiple heat settings allow for customized drying experiences tailored to individual hair types. This is especially important for grey hair, as it is typically more delicate and sensitive to heat exposure. Lower temperature settings can aid in drying the hair without compromising its health, preventing potential damage that could arise from excessive heat.

Additionally, weight and ergonomics matter when selecting a hair dryer, particularly for seniors or those with mobility issues. A lightweight design fosters ease of use, allowing for convenient styling without straining the wrist or arm. These ergonomic considerations can enhance user experience, making it more enjoyable to care for grey hair over time.

Buying Guide for Best Hair Dryers For Grey Hair

When it comes to maintaining and styling grey hair, using the right hair dryer can make a significant difference. Grey hair often requires special care due to its unique texture and potential for dryness. The best hair dryers for grey hair can provide the necessary heat and technology to ensure your locks remain healthy, shiny, and vibrant. In this buying guide, we will explore the essential factors you should consider when selecting a hair dryer that best suits your needs.

1. Heat Settings

One of the most critical factors to consider is the heat settings that the hair dryer offers. Grey hair can be particularly sensitive to heat, which means you want to look for a dryer that has multiple heat settings. This versatility allows you to select a lower heat setting to prevent damage while still achieving effective drying and styling. Additionally, finer grey hair may require less heat due to its fragility, making adjustable settings crucial.

Moreover, specialized hair dryers often include a cool shot function, which is excellent for setting your style after drying. Using a cooler temperature can help lock in moisture and protect the hair cuticle, making it an essential feature for those with grey hair. With the right heat settings, you can cater to your hair’s specific needs, ensuring it remains healthy and manageable.

2. Ionic Technology

Ionic technology is another important feature to consider when looking for the best hair dryers for grey hair. Hair dryers equipped with ionic technology emit negative ions that help break down water molecules, leading to faster drying times. This is especially beneficial for grey hair, which often tends to be drier and may require more moisture retention during the drying process.

In addition to reduced drying time, ionic hair dryers can help minimize frizz and promote shine. The negative ions neutralize static electricity, which can be a common issue with grey hair. By using a dryer with ionic technology, you not only save time but also improve the overall appearance of your hair, leaving it smoother and healthier.

3. Weight and Ergonomics

The weight and ergonomics of a hair dryer are essential to consider, especially for those who may have limited strength or dexterity. Lightweight models are easier to handle and maneuver, reducing the strain on your arms and wrists during the drying process. If you style your hair daily, a lighter hair dryer can make a significant difference in comfort, allowing you to achieve your desired look without discomfort.

Additionally, the design and grip of the hair dryer play a role in its usability. An ergonomic handle can provide a more comfortable hold, making the drying process easier. Look for models with well-placed buttons that are easy to access without having to shift your grip. By choosing a user-friendly design, you can enhance your styling experience and make hair drying a hassle-free task.

4. Attachment Options

When purchasing a hair dryer, the available attachments can significantly impact your styling capabilities. Most quality hair dryers come with a variety of diffusers, concentrators, and comb attachments that cater to different hairstyles and hair types. For grey hair, a concentrator nozzle can help direct airflow precisely, allowing for smoother straight styles or controlled volume.

A diffuser is particularly valuable if you have naturally textured hair or want to enhance waves without causing frizz. This attachment spreads the heat over a larger area, which can help minimize damage and retain moisture, vital for grey hair maintenance. Evaluate the attachments included with the hair dryer to ensure you can achieve the hairstyles you desire while benefiting your specific hair needs.

5. Wattage

Wattage is a key factor that influences the performance of a hair dryer. Higher wattage typically means more power, which can translate to faster drying times. Many professional-grade hair dryers operate between 1800 to 2400 watts, making them efficient choices, especially for thicker or longer grey hair that can absorb more moisture and take longer to dry.

However, it’s essential to balance wattage with heat settings to prevent potential damage. A high-wattage dryer with adjustable heat settings offers versatility and control over the drying process. Look for a model that provides a good amount of wattage while still prioritizing heat protection and hair care, ensuring that your styling routine is both efficient and safe for your hair type.

3. How do I prevent damage to my grey hair when using a hair dryer?

To prevent damage when using a hair dryer on grey hair, it’s vital to utilize the appropriate heat settings. Always start with the lowest heat setting and gradually increase if necessary. Limiting the use of high heat is essential to protect the hair’s integrity. Additionally, ensure you maintain a distance of at least six inches from your scalp and hair to prevent overheating any single area.

Using a heat protectant spray is another great way to shield your grey hair from potential heat damage. These products create a barrier against the heat, helping to prevent moisture loss and brittleness. Make it a habit to incorporate a nourishing leave-in conditioner as well; this will help maintain hydration levels and improve your hair’s overall resilience to styling tools.
